PALEO GARLIC BREAD

Ingredients

1/2 cup palm shortening or olive oil

1/2 cup water

1 teaspoon sea salt

3/4 cup tapioca flour

1/4 cup coconut flour

1 large egg

1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ning

1/2 teaspoon fresh chopped garlic

Instructions

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.

In a small pan combine the olive oil, water and sea salt and bring to a boil.

Remove from heat and add in the garlic and then the tapioca flour.

Mix thoroughly and let rest for 5 minutes.

Add in the in Italian seasoning and egg.

Mix in the coconut flour and then knead the dough for 1 minute on a piece of baking parchment.

Divide dough into equal size pieces and roll them into balls.

Place the rolls   on a greased baking sheet/lined baking sheet/silicone mat

Bake for 30 – 40 minutes

Cool on a rack
